What is the e signature legitimacy for polygraph consent in Mexico
The e signature legitimacy for polygraph consent in Mexico refers to the legal recognition of electronic signatures used in documents related to polygraph testing. This legitimacy ensures that electronic signatures hold the same weight as traditional handwritten signatures, provided they meet specific legal standards. In Mexico, electronic signatures are governed by the Federal Law on Electronic Signatures, which outlines the criteria for validity, including the need for a secure signature creation device and proper identification of the signatory.

Legal use of the e signature legitimacy for polygraph consent in Mexico
The legal use of e signatures for polygraph consent in Mexico is supported by the Federal Law on Electronic Signatures, which establishes the framework for their acceptance in legal matters. To ensure compliance, organizations must utilize secure electronic signature solutions that provide authentication and integrity measures. This legal backing allows businesses and individuals to confidently use e signatures in polygraph testing scenarios, knowing that their documents are legally binding.
